Farmington, Missouri (August 21, 2023) – The City of Farmington would like to remind citizens that if relief is needed from the daytime heat because of predicted high heat indices over the next several days, any City building that is accessible to the public during normal business hours may be used as a cooling shelter. Water will be available at these locations.

“The National Weather Service says we could potentially have heat indices of 105 to 120 degrees through at least Thursday and possibly Friday,” said Farmington Emergency Management Director Johsua McAtee.

McAtee says during a Heat Advisory, it's important to take precautions to prevent heat related illness and injuries. Limit outdoor activity if possible. Drink plenty of water and wear light weight, loose fitting clothing. Never leave people or pets in a vehicle.

1. Stay in an air-conditioned indoor location as much as you can. If you don't have air conditioning at home, consider going to a public place with air conditioning such as the places listed above.

2. Drink plenty of fluids even if you don’t feel thirsty. Avoid drinks with caffeine or alcohol as they can dehydrate you.

3. Wear loose, lightweight, light-colored clothing and sunscreen. This will help protect your skin from the sun and keep you cool.

4. Pace yourself and avoid strenuous activities. If you must do outdoor activities, try to do them during the coolest part of the day such as early morning or late evening.

5. Schedule outdoor activities carefully. Try to limit your outdoor activity to when it’s coolest outside.

6. Use a buddy system and monitor those at risk, such as children, the elderly, and people with chronic conditions. Also take care of your pets, especially those who are left outside during the day.

School starts this Tuesday, August 22nd. Please be patient as our students and drivers adjust to their bus routes. Also, please watch for students crossing the streets and waiting for their bus to arrive. Red lights mean all directions must stop (unless the bus is on the other side of a median OR on the other side of a 4-lane highway), and yellow lights mean slow down; the bus is about to stop!
